DNA BASED SENSORS

This abstract first appeared for US patent application 20250093360 titled 'DNA BASED SENSORS

Original Abstract Submitted

provided is a nanoparticle comprising: a dna scaffold comprising an attached dye, an attached functional moiety, or a combination thereof. in some embodiments, the dna scaffold comprises a plurality of dna oligonucleotides, wherein each oligonucleotide is independently optionally attached to a dye and/or a functional moiety. provided is a method of cell voltage sensing at a target site comprising providing the nanoparticle of any one of the preceding embodiments at the target site; and monitoring cell voltage at the target site. also provided is a method of fluorescence or absorbance imaging at a target site comprising providing the nanoparticle of any one of the preceding embodiments at the target site; and monitoring fluorescence or absorbance at the target site.
